Collection of Images from Events in TamesideTameside Arts and Events Team are responsible for organising an annual programme of public events and heritage projects throughout the Borough and for co-ordinating a range of community arts projects in Tameside. The Team is made up of eight full time members of staff:

  • Principal Arts and Events Manager
  • Senior Arts and Events Manager
  • Arts and Events Manager (x3)
  • Arts Development Officer
  • Admin Assistant
  • Modern Apprentice

Community Arts

Current community arts projects include involvement in a number of Greater Manchester initiatives like the GMMAZ Youth Music Project Link to External Website, and the Pixelate Project Link to External Website involving live internet broadcasts from Tameside. Arts and Regeneration work in Tameside encourages creative activity in the region - from helping community groups plan and deliver arts activities in their areas, to providing marketing and funding assistance for the local artists network at Woodend Mill Link to External Website in nearby Mossley, and much more inbetween.

The Tameside Local History Forum

The Forum was established in January 2000 to increase public awareness and use of all the elements of local history throughout the Borough. The aim is to promote the study of archive and source material for social, business and archaeological purposes, and to make sure that such material is well preserved, collated and accessible to all.
